Local Weather Risks in Nemo

🌪️

Triggers

Heavy rainstorms, flash flooding, hail damage, and high humidity (typical in North Texas) are the most common triggers. Any event that allows moisture into a structure — roof leaks, window seal failures, foundation cracks — can rapidly lead to mold growth.

📅

Seasonal Risks

Mold emergencies in Nemo spike during the spring and fall rainy seasons, and after any severe weather event. High humidity combined with warm temperatures creates ideal conditions for mold to take hold within 24–48 hours after water exposure.

🏚️

Disaster Scenarios

In the aftermath of severe storms, tornadoes, or extended power outages (affecting AC/dehumidifiers), properties in and around Nemo face elevated mold risks. Flooded crawl spaces, saturated drywall, and soaked insulation require emergency drying and mold remediation to prevent structural damage and health hazards.

Emergency Prevention Tips

  • Fix leaks immediately — any dripping pipe, roof leak, or window seal failure can feed mold growth within 24 hours
  • Keep indoor humidity below 60% (ideally 30–50%) using dehumidifiers and proper ventilation, especially during Nemo's humid months
  • Ensure gutters and downspouts direct water at least 10 feet away from your foundation
  • After any flooding or water intrusion, begin drying within 24 hours using fans, dehumidifiers, and professional water extraction
  • Check HVAC systems regularly — condensation pans should drain properly and filters should be changed monthly during peak seasons

Emergency Service FAQs

Common questions about emergency mold remediation in Nemo

How quickly does mold grow after water damage?

Mold can begin to grow within 24 to 48 hours of moisture exposure. In Nemo's warm and humid climate, this timeline can be even shorter. If you have had water intrusion, immediate action is critical.

Is black mold really that dangerous?

Stachybotrys chartarum (often called black mold) produces mycotoxins that can cause respiratory issues, headaches, fatigue, and allergic reactions. Infants, elderly, and those with compromised immune systems are especially vulnerable. Any toxic mold growth should be handled by professionals.

Can I just clean the mold myself with bleach?

For small patches on non-porous surfaces, household cleaners may work. However, bleach does not kill mold on porous materials like drywall or wood. For any growth larger than 10 square feet, or if you suspect HVAC contamination, professional remediation is strongly recommended.

How do I know if mold is hiding behind my walls?

Signs include persistent musty odors, peeling wallpaper or paint, warped walls, and unexplained allergy symptoms. Moisture meters and thermal imaging used by professionals can detect hidden moisture and mold without destructive inspection.

Does homeowners insurance cover mold remediation in Texas?

Coverage varies widely. Most policies cover mold remediation if it results from a covered peril (like a burst pipe or storm damage), but may cap payouts or exclude mold from flood damage. Check your policy and speak with your provider directly.

What should I do while waiting for the mold remediation team to arrive?

Turn off your HVAC system to prevent spore circulation. Avoid disturbing the mold — do not sweep or vacuum it. If possible, isolate the affected room by closing doors and sealing gaps with tape. Limit time in contaminated areas, especially for children and anyone with respiratory conditions.
